HI

I am looking for a contribution which will check that the cart has a minimum number of items at checkout time and issue a message if below the minimom number and return customer to a shopping page.

As yet I havent found one but was hoping someone may have a lead on something similar.

checkout_shipping.php

if ($cart->count_contents() < 6) tep_redirect(tep_href_link(FILENAME_SHOPPING_CART, 'error_message=' . urlencode(sprintf(MORE_ITEMS_NEEDED, $cart->count_contents()), 'NONSSL'));

includes/languages/english.php

define('MORE_ITEMS_NEEDED', 'You have only %s items in your basket.  Add more you fool.');
#

Completely untested

I created a simple way to do it. You can see it working live on www.trendynailwraps.co.uk section Purchase
(or on www.dgweb.ie/_osc_trendy_nail_wraps during development phase)

1) Open catalog/chechout_shipping.php

Locate:
// if there is nothing in the customers cart, redirect them to the shopping cart page
if ($cart->count_contents() < 3) {
tep_redirect(tep_href_link(FILENAME_PRIVACY));
}

Replace by :
// if there is nothing in the customers cart, redirect them to the shopping cart page
if ($cart->count_contents() < 3) {
tep_redirect(tep_href_link(FILENAME_MIN_ITEMCART));
}


2)Open /includes/filenames.php
add this line:

define('FILENAME_MIN_ITEMCART', 'min_itemcart.php');


3) Open catalog/privacy.php

Find any places in the file that has that in it:
FILENAME_PRIVACY

Replace by:
FILENAME_MIN_ITEMCART

(CTRL-F then Replace)

Save it as min_itemcart.php and place it in catalog/


4) create a file named min_itemcart.php with the following lines and place it in catalog/includes/languages/english/

<?php

define('NAVBAR_TITLE', 'Important Note');
define('HEADING_TITLE', 'Important Note');

define('TEXT_INFORMATION', 'The minimum purchase requirement is ANY 3 SHEETS.');
?>


That's it! You have it all done now...
